Shane McCarron dedd33d975 fix(install): respect $CLAUDE_CONFIG_DIR in install/uninstall/update
Route Claude Code config paths (skills, .mcp.json, .claude.json,
settings.json, hook scripts) and agent detection through
CLAUDE_CONFIG_DIR-aware helpers, falling back to ~/.claude. Hook command
strings written to settings.json keep the legacy tilde form when the env
var is unset, so existing configs stay portable across HOME values. Prints
a one-line migration nudge when CLAUDE_CONFIG_DIR is set and a legacy
~/.claude tree still exists.

Adds cli_detect_agents_finds_claude_via_env and isolates CLAUDE_CONFIG_DIR
in the existing detection tests so the runner env can't leak in.

Distilled from #321 onto current main (adapts to the v0.7.0 non-blocking
augmenter hook signature, which the original branch predated). Closes #320.

Martin Vogel cd1417427c Add 8-layer security test suite + hardening
Code-level defenses:
- cbm_validate_shell_arg(): reject shell metacharacters before popen/system
- SQLite authorizer: block ATTACH/DETACH at engine level
- CORS localhost-only origin reflection (replaces wildcard *)
- Path containment: realpath() check in get_code_snippet
- process-kill restricted to server-spawned PIDs
- SHA256 checksum verification in update command

Security audit scripts (8 layers):
- L1: Static allow-list for dangerous calls + URLs
- L2: Binary string audit (URLs, payloads, credentials)
- L3: Network egress monitoring via strace (Linux)
- L4: Install output path + content validation
- L5: Smoke test hardening (clean shutdown, residual procs)
- L6: Graph UI audit (external domains, CORS, binding)
- L7: MCP robustness (23 adversarial JSON-RPC payloads)
- L8: Vendored integrity (checksums + dangerous call scan)

CI: parallel security-static job (no build needed), binary
layers in smoke jobs per-platform. Cleanup of test fixture
dirs in clean.sh + .gitignore.
